EAA AirVenture is the world’s largest gathering of general aviation aircraft. It is held each July at Wittman Regional Airport in Oshkosh, Wis. Of the approximate 12,000 aircraft that fly in to the southeastern Wisconsin airport, hundreds are vintage and modern warbirds flown in from all over the world by EAA members. Included are bombers and fighters from World War II, cargo and support planes, trainers, and even foreign aircraft. During the daily airshow these warbird pilots participate in some of the largest aerial formations in these types of aircraft performed anywhere in the world.
